Real Madrid have officially confirmed the signing of Eintracht Frankfurt striker Luka Jovic.
Luka Jovic has joined Real Madrid on a six-year deal for a reported fee of €60 m. The 21-year-old Serbia striker has enjoyed a breakthrough 2018/19 season for Eintracht Frankfurt. Jovic became one of Europe’s most in-demand players after scoring 17 Bundesliga goals and a further 10 goals in Eintracht’s run to the semi-finals of the Europa League.
The Bundesliga club, Eintracht Frankfurt have made a massive profit on the 21-year-old as they only trigged a purchase option in his loan deal from Benfica for a reported €6m in April. Benfica will also pocket €12m from the deal after inserting a 20 per cent sell-on-clause in his official departure last month.

Luka Jovic will have to compete with Karim Benzema and Mariano Diaz for the central striking role in Zinedine Zidane’s starting XI. Jovic’s primary objective will be to score goals. But he will also need to demonstrate a willingness to contribute to the greater good if he is to usurp Benzema as the club’s pre-eminent forward.
In addition to his goals last season, Benzema provided 10 assists for his team-mates. This meant he was involved in a goal every 107.60 minutes throughout the campaign. He also created a whopping 70 chances and completed almost 58 per cent of his attempted dribbles. Jovic has an even better rate of involvement, his six assists ensuring that he played a part in a goal every 100.15 minutes. He created far fewer chances than Benzema, though, just 37, and did not enjoy as much success with dribbles, completing 42 per cent of those attempted. Mariano was nowhere near the level of Jovic or Benzema. He created only eight chances during his stop-start campaign, failing to contribute a single assist. So, Jovic’s main competitor at the club will be Benzema. He needs to learn from the big Frenchman. Benzema won’t be getting any younger, so Jovic is the player Real Madrid would want to develop for the future.

The FIFA Women’s World Cup 2019 will start on 7th June. This time the tournament is being hosted by France. This is the first time France will be hosting the tournament and the third time Europe will be doing so. The final of the tournament will be played on 7th July at the Parc Olympique Lyonnais, also known as Groupama Stadium. The venue is the home of Ligue 1 side Lyon. This stadium is France’s largest-capacity venue and will be able to hold 59,186 fans.
World Cup groups
24 countries will take in this tournament for claiming the highest honour in international football. The 24 teams will be divided into 6 groups of 4 teams each. The winner and runner-up team of each group will automatically progress to the round of 16. Also, four third-place teams who will accumulate the most points will also advance to the knockout stage.

Some facts about this World Cup
Four teams – Chile, Jamaica, Scotland and South Africa – will make their Women’s World Cup debuts.
There is also a debut for VAR after it was used at last summer’s men’s World Cup.
Jamaica are the first Caribbean team to ever feature.
Brazilian midfielder Formiga could play in her SEVENTH World Cup. At 41, she could become the oldest player to ever feature at the tournament.
Barcelona have 13 players at France 2019, a new Women’s World Cup record for a single club.

Cupertino giant Apple launches their new Mac Pro with Xeon processors and Vega II GPUs at the WWDC 2019 with a starting price tag of $5999
Apple made some huge announcements at its own event WWDC 2019, most of them seemed to be software announcements and among them, the only hardware launch was the new Mac Pro.
Apple finally ditches the trash-can design of the last Mac Pro and brings back the tower design clad in Aluminium. It also features some great specs for professionals who need power-packed performance.
Introducing the most configurable, expandable Mac ever and the world’s best pro display. Mac Pro has a Xeon processor with up to 28 cores, numerous expansion slots, and the most memory capacity ever in a Mac. It also offers the world’s most powerful graphics card and a new accelerator card that eliminates the need for proxy workflows.
Intel Xeon Processors
The new Mac Pro is powered by Intel’s Xeon CPUs that has options up to 28 cores, the best one can get for a PC workstation. Also to cool such high workstation CPUs that consume up to 300 Watts of power, a massive heat sink keeps the system cool, enabling it to run fully unconstrained. The CPU options are:
8 cores, 16 threads, 3.5 GHz base clock speed, 4.0 GHz base clock speed, 24.5 MB cache
12 cores, 24 threads, 3.3 GHz base clock speed, 4.4 GHz base clock speed, 31.25 MB cache
16 cores, 32 threads, 3.2 GHz base clock speed, 4.4 GHz base clock speed, 38 MB cache
24 cores, 48 threads, 2.7 GHz base clock speed, 4.4 GHz base clock speed, 57 MB cache
28 cores, 56 threads, 2.5 GHz base clock speed, 4.4 GHz base clock speed, 66.5 MB cache
It features six channels of superfast ECC memory and 12 physical DIMM slots, the new Mac Pro allows up to 1.5TB of huge DDR4 ECC memory. The RAM support is up to 2933MHz DDR4 ECC memory and a memory bandwidth of up to 140GB/s.
AMD Radeon Pro Vega II Duo graphics
Coming to the graphics, you get up to two Radeon Pro Vega II Duo MPX Modules. The four GPUs combine to add up to 56 teraflops and 128 GB of high-bandwidth memory and come with 8 PCIe Gen 3 slots.
With 14 teraflops of computing performance, 32GB of memory, and 1TB/s of memory bandwidth, the MPX Module with Radeon Pro Vega II is a powerhouse. For more power, two Radeon Pro Vega II GPUs combine to create the Vega II Duo.
With double the graphics performance, memory, and memory bandwidth, it’s the world’s most powerful graphics card. The two GPUs are connected through the Infinity Fabric Link, which allows data transfer up to 5x faster between the GPUs.
The GPU alone could consume up to 500 watts of power for an MPX Module. So, Apple has put a humongous 1400W power supply into the Mac Pro.
The Cupertino giant has also implemented a hardware accelerator to the new Mac Pro called ‘Afterburner’ and according to Apple, the Mac Pro has enough power to play up to 3 streams of 8K ProRes video files simultaneously.
Security, Storage & I/O
For the security of all the data kept in the Mac Pro, Apple’s own Apple T2 Security Chip. It integrates with discrete processors into a single chip ensuring deepest security to the lowest levels of softwares.
Coming to the storage, the new Mac Pro starts with a 256GB SSD and is configurable to a 1TB, 2TB, or 4TB SSD — all encrypted by the T2 chip.
Mac Pro has extremely high-performance I/O and it starts with four Thunderbolt 3 ports, two USB-A ports, and two 10 GB Ethernet ports.
You can connect up to 12 4K displays or up to six Pro Display XDRs from Apple and see your work with over 120 million pixels.
Visit here to know more about all the specifications. The new Mac Pro will have a start price $5,999, for the base variant with an 8-core Intel Xeon processor, 32 GB of RAM, 256 GB SSD, and a Radeon Pro 580X GPU, and will be available this fall.
Apple Pro Display XDR
To accompany the new powerful Mac Pro, the Cupertino giant also announced the new Pro Display XDR. It is basically a 6K resolution reference monitor with a starting price tag of $4,999.
This is an insane display with 10-bit colour, 1,600 nits of brightness and 1,000,000:1 contrast ratio. It gives you the power to maintain extreme brightness without ever dimming.
Along with efficient backlight control, this delivers outstanding contrast between the brightest brights and the blackest blacks. With the breakthrough in backlighting technology, Pro Display XDR takes brightness, contrast, and colour to a new level. Far beyond the High Dynamic Range or HDR, it’s now Extreme Dynamic Range (XDR).
The Pro Stand has an adjustable height with a travel of 120 millimetres, also you can tilt and rotate the display into landscape or portrait according to your need.
You have two options with the display – either go for the Apple Pro Stand for $999 or use a $199 VESA mount adapter to attach it, but you’ll still miss the amazing flexibility that the Pro Stand offers in return of a hefty amount.
The baseline Mac Pro with a baseline Pro Display XDR and the Pro Stand will cost you an $11,997 without including tax or shipping.

Samsung announces its partnership with silicon giant AMD for their upcoming Exynos chips to implement RDNA graphics to gaming smartphones
The South Korean smartphone manufacturer who is the number one in smartphone sales around the globe are taking a huge leap in smartphone graphics. The other day it has declared a multiyear partnership with AMD to implement their new RDNA architecture to new age Exynos chips.
Samsung does make its own chips to power its own smartphones, but they have lagged behind Qualcomm for one reason mostly – the GPU. The Mali GPU isn’t that great especially at the premium segment, people expect more powerful graphics in this smartphone gaming era.
To bridge the gap and make new generation mobile SoCs with powerful graphics, Samsung ties its hand with graphics giant AMD and use their architecture for developing.
Previously they tried to make something of its own but NVIDIA did file a claim against Samsung to use their GPU design without proper licensing. This legal battle went for long days and ended with nothing for both sides.
It’s hard to see how two technological giants avoid each other in spite of the fact remains that NVIDIA uses their memory in the GPUs.
AMD introduced their new RDNA architecture at the Computex 2019
This significantly hurt Samsung’s own Exynos chips, because they never failed to implement the horsepower. Samsung even developed the 7nm based SoCs that is currently used in the Galaxy S10 and S10+.
They lagged behind the likes of Apple Bionic chips and Qualcomm Snapdragon chips by a huge margin if graphics is taken into comparison. Now, gaming smartphones are very popular these days and is basically ruling the market.
Gaming smartphones require a lot of GPU as well as CPU power, which Samsung is lacking in the graphics department. Using AMD’s new RDNA architecture will help Samsung to use its design on the new gaming chips for gaming smartphones.

Bangladesh became the second side in this World Cup so far to bat more than 40 overs.
Bangladesh put up a score of 330/6 in their 50 overs in their World Cup 2019 match against South Africa at the Oval on Sunday. The highest score in this edition of the tournament so far.
South Africa won the toss and opted to bowl first. Batting first Bangladesh batted brilliantly.
Soumya Sarkar played an agressive innings of 42 runs. Shakib al Hasan took charge of the innings after the dismissal of Tamim Iqbal.
Shakib scored 75 runs of 84 balls. His innings consisted of 8 fours and a six.
Mushfiqur Rahim supported Shakib, made handsome contributions to the total at the top of the order. Rahim scored 78 runs, with 8 boundaries. Mahmudullah came up with an attacking blitz towards the end. He scored 46 runs at the end,which took Bangladesh past 330.
330/6 is the highest ever ODI total put up by Bangladesh.
Their previous best was 329/6, vs Pakistan in Dhaka in 2015.
The 142-run partnership for the third wicket between Shakib and Mushfiqur is the highest ever partnership in World Cup history for Bangladesh. Their previous best partnership in World Cups was 141 for the fifth wicket vs England in 2015.
Shakib Al Hasan’s 75 is the highest ever score for a Bangladesh No. 3 vs South Africa. It is also the highest ever for a Bangladesh No. 3 in a World Cup match.
Bangladesh also became only the second side in this World Cup after England to bat in the death overs (41-50 overs). On both occasions, the bowling side have been South Africa. All other sides’ innings have been wrapped up before 40 overs.
Shakib al Hasan picked up his 250th ODI wicket when he got Aiden Markram out. He is now one among only five all-rounders with 5000 runs and 250 wickets in ODIs.
Shahkib is the fastest to this landmark though. He has reached this landmark in 199 ODIs.

Smart TV vs Android TV
Smart TV is basically just another TV with WiFi and have some most demanding apps like NetFlix, Hulu, Amazon Prime and all. You also get options to browse the net or watch YouTube. These TVs simple have a all-in-one remote that lets you operate it. Honestly, Smart TVs are quite enough to satisfy your content hunger.
Android TVs are more advanced and flexible enough as because they give you to use Google Play Store and use all apps that are already optimized to be used on your Android TV, just like how you interact with your smartphone Android OS.
The smooth Android interface gives you flexible options to use your TV accordingly – play games, download as many apps as you want, watch any content using an app.

Jose Antonio Reyes, former Sevilla and Arsenal star has died in a traffic accident today
Jose Antonio Reyes will always be remembered as a Sevilla great. He died today at a young age of 35 in a traffic accident. The whole footballing fraternity is mourning at the unexpected death of a great footballer.
Sevilla sporting director, Monchi helped to discover Reyes in his childhood days. He described the winger’s importance at Estadio Ramon Sanchez Pizjuan, telling SFC Radio: “He was the most innate talent that came out of the academy. Not needing to improve on anything, he was already good, and what’s more, with his sale he allowed the club to grow, and then he came back to win another three titles. He is Sevilla history. I’ve been numb since the chairman called me, trying to wake up from what I want to be a nightmare but tragically seems to be real.”
Reyes is still the youngest player to ever represent Sevilla in LaLiga. He made his debut at 16 years, 4 months and 29 days in January 2000. He had a successful 20-year career that began in his childhood club Sevilla. Reyes has made 686 appearances in club football, which took him from Spain to England, Portugal and China. He is the only player to win the Europa League 5 times.
Jose Antonio Reyes signed for Arsenal in January 2004. He was a part of Arsene Wenger’s “Invincibles” who won the Premier League unbeaten. He scored 2 goals in 13 appearances. After his time in Arsenal, Reyes was loaned to Real Madrid. Reyes scored two crucial goals against Real Mallorca to secure the title for the Los Blancos. From Real Madrid, he went on a permanent move to Atletico Madrid where he won the Europa League. Then surprisingly Reyes returned to his childhood club Sevilla once again in January 2012. He got the Sevilla success he dreamed of, winning three straight Europa League titles to take his personal tally to five – a record which he holds till now.
For all the inconsistency, there was also sheer talent and joy – in full-flight he was every child’s idea of what a footballer should be. Reyes departed as a hero in 2016 and went on to represent Espanyol and Cordoba. He recently signed for Extremadura in January, having spent 2018 at China League One club Xinjiang Tianshan Leopard. He saved Extremadura from relegation this season.

Eden Hazard joined Chelsea from Lille in 2012. He quickly adapted to the Premier League and became of the Premier League’s best. He has won two Premier League and two Europa League at Chelsea and also the FA Cup and EFL Cup.
In his seven years at the club, Hazard made 352 appearances across all competitions. He has scored 110 goals and provided 81 assists. He is also the third all-time highest goal scorer in the Premier League for Chelsea with 85 goals. The 2018-19 season was Hazard’s best in terms of goals for Chelsea. He scored 21 goals across all competitions. Hazard’s best campaign for assists was 2012-13 when he created 19 goals. This term he laid on 17, with 15 coming in the Premier League to make him the most creative player across Europe’s top five leagues. The Belgian attempted (1,441) and complete (909) more dribbles than any other Premier League player since the start of the 2012-13 season.
